A gauge theory generalization of the fermion-doubling theorem

Published 17 Jun 2013 in hep-th and cond-mat.str-el | (1306.3992v1)

Abstract: It is possible to characterize certain states of matter by properties of their edge states. This implies a notion of `surface-only models': models which can only be regularized at the edge of a higher-dimensional system. After incorporating the fermion-doubling results of Nielsen and Ninomiya into this framework, we employ this idea to identify new obstructions to symmetry-preserving regulators of quantum field theory. We focus on an example which forbids regulated models of Maxwell theory with manifest electromagnetic duality symmetry.
